Jamaica never sleeps. At least, that’s true for Kingston, Negril, Montego Bay and Ocho Rios. Negril is best for beach parties while Kingston has the slickest nightclubs, the best music events and street dances. Things rarely get going before midnight and revelers party until sunrise. But finding flights to get there can be a c...Feb 24, 2023 · Areas of Kingston, Montego Bay, and Spanish Town are the three most dangerous neighborhoods in Jamaica. These places have a theme of violent crime, theft, sexual assault and rape, gun crime, and gang wars. Tourists are advised to not enter these districts by Jamaican police and travel advisory bodies. In 2017, Jamaica’s homicide rate was 56 per 100,000; in 2018, the homicide rate dropped to 47 per 100,000 but remains three times higher than the average for Latin America and the Caribbean. According to the Jamaica Tourist Board, in 2017 the island received 4.3 million tourists. Taxis are an excellent way to get around Jamaica. For safe and pleasant travel, opt for taxis from Jamaica’s official taxi service – JUTA (Jamaica Union of Travellers Association) or an approved taxi company. Stick to agreed-upon fares before the journey starts. It ensures you’re not caught off guard by unexpected costs.2 Port Antonio Is Probably Okay. Feb 9, 2024 · Prime Minister of Jamaica Andrew Holness recently questioned the alignment of the recent U.S. travel advisory with Jamaica’s significant strides in reducing crime rates. According to Holness, Jamaica is at the lowest level of crime in more than 22 years. “Though the rates of crime are declining, sadly, the perception has not moved in the ...
